I currently use 2 8 gen but the are both high processor. I use one for playing FM24 game and the other for general use. I find the perfectly ok for me and I even edit photos, play vids etc no problem. I think for around £100 you can't go wrong. But I stress you need the top end CPUs and I would buget £50 extra for adding a SSD. My aim would be to get a one owner with nothing added to the basic model then add the SSD and perhaps extra ram. Make sure you check the hinges out. Answer from Deleted User on reddit.com

Coffee Lake - Wikipedia
1 month ago - Coffee Lake's development was led by Intel Israel's processor design team in Haifa, Israel, as an optimization of Kaby Lake. Intel first launched its 8th Generation Intel Core family processors in August 2017. While with the release of the new 8th Gen Intel Core i9 processor in 2018, Intel ...

8th Generation Laptops: What You Need to Know - PSERO LAPTOP
March 30, 2025 - 8th Gen laptops are still reliable and capable for general computing, office work, and light gaming. If you’re looking for an affordable, well-performing laptop, it’s still a good option. However, if you want cutting-edge performance, consider newer generations (10th to 13th Gen Intel or AMD Ryzen 5000/7000 series).

Question - i5 8th gen for 2024 and beyond? | Tom's Hardware Forum
June 15, 2024 - Worst case scenario the next-gen Windows will release and his 8th-gen CPU will not support it; however, his school requiring such is highly unlikely. ... And worst case, you can load Linux Mint on it. You can find alternatives for a lot of apps you'd use on Windows, if the actual app doesn't have a Linux version. ... For the applications you mentioned: the answer is yes, it’s still viable. SPSS can run on a potato. Perhaps the more important consideration is the age of the battery (8365U is laptop spec), which likely needs replacement.
